工单详细设计说明书内容摘要:

”。 当位数超过限制时 ,显示信息 ”所输入的字符超长 ,请重新输入 ”; ②输入内容确认处理 根据输入的工单类别标题内容,对 tasktype 表进行更新处理。 当修改处理成功时,显示“修改成功”提示信息;当重复修改时,显示“重复修改”提示信息;当修改失败时,显示“修改失败”提示信息。 ③ 对数据库操作错误时的处理。 当数据库操作出错时,系统应该自动捕捉异常,显示错误信息。 2. [取消 ]按钮的处理 单击此按钮后,输入框中的内容被清空,光标置于 工单 类别标题 输入框 中。 D— 删除工单 类别 D1 删除工单类别页面 D2 删除工单类别按钮 序号 对象 说明 1 删除 单击此按钮对删除操作进行 确认 D3 按钮单击处理设计 ( [取消 ]按钮的处理) 单击此按钮后,系统调用控制程序,作如下处理。 ① 删除工单类别 先从 task 表中查询是否有该类别的工单,若有则删除该类别记录,否则提示不能删除信息。 ②对数据库操作出错时的处理 当数据库操作出错时,系统自动捕捉有异常,显示出错信息。 控制层设计 设计文档名称 控制层设计 设计者 杨学瑜 完成日期 202055 子模块名 程序名称 文件路径名 开发预定工期 (学时 ) A数据操作 jsp/task/ 4 A 数据操作 A1 输入数据处理 1 对输入数据的类型转换。 页面传递来的工单类别 id 值是 String 型,由于数据库及实体类中 id 属性是 int,因此需要转换。 2 对输入数据去空格处理。 由于在页面输入数据时,有可能使用空格键,产生一些空格字符,因此必须使用 String的 trim()方法去掉这些无用的字符。 3 创建 Task Type 对象,为对象赋值。 在业务逻辑类及数据访问类中的许多方法的参数为 Task Type 对象,因此在控制层要创建 Task Type 对象,为该对象赋值,目的是把页面获取的信息暂存到对象中,为下一步的数据操作做准备。 首先使用 new 关键字创建 Task Type 对象,然后使用该类的 set XXX()方法为该对象赋值,即把客户端的数据保存到 Task Type 对象中。 A2 导入 java Bean 要导入 task. service 包中的 ITaskTypeService 接口和 TaskTypeService 类文件中。 A3 控制逻辑描述 1 如果 Type=1,则调用 ITaskTypeService 中的 add(TaskType tt) 方法; 2 如果 Type=2,则调用 ITaskTypeService 中的。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。